A pilsner is just a pilsner unless there is lemon and orange peel in it. That’s Mikkeller Citrus Dream, headed stateside in 2013.
Style: Pilsner (w/ Orange & Lemon Peel)
Availability: 11.2oz bottles
Arrival: TBA
